Mexican Pinwheels

Mexican pinwheels are bite-size tortilla rolls filled with a spiced cream cheese mixture. They are a party in your mouth!

Ingredients

  • 1 (8-ounce) package cream cheese, softened
  • ½ cup sour cream
  • ¼ cup salsa
  • 2 tablespoons taco seasoning
  • dash garlic powder
  • 1 (4-ounces) can chopped green chilies
  • 1 cup Mexican cheese, finely shredded
  • 8 (10-inch) flour tortillas
  • salsa, on the side

Instructions

  • Add cream cheese, sour cream, salsa, taco seasoning, and garlic powder to a small bowl. Mix together until smooth. Add the chilies and cheese and stir.
  • Scoop ½-¾ cup of the mixture onto each 10-inch tortilla. Spread the mixture to cover the tortilla.
  • Roll each tortilla like you would a jelly roll. Line them up, seam side down, in a baking dish. Cover the dish and place it in the fridge to chill for 2 hours overnight.
  • After they have chilled slice each tortilla roll into 1-inch pieces. Place them side by side on a serving tray so that you can see the rolled layers. Serve with salsa.

Notes

Make ahead of time. Slice the rolls up to 24 hours in advance and keep them covered with plastic wrap in the fridge.
Store leftovers in an airtight container, with plastic directly on top to keep them from drying out, and keep them in the refrigerator for about 3 days, or freeze for up to 3 months.
